Overview

Grove Site Services is currently looking for qualified Carpenters for temporary ongoing work in the Vale of Glamorgan area.

Responsibilities

  • Work includes first and second fix carpentry

Requirements

  • Relevant carpentry experience
  • CSCS card preferred but not essential
  • Reliable and hardworking attitude

What we offer

We offer competitive rates (based on experience), van and fuel provided, ongoing contract for the right candidates
